I'm looking for a good set of 26" whitewalls for my Schwinn Cruiser build, but would like to go with bigger than a 26x2.125 whitewall, maybe a 26x3? Most of the fat whitewalls I see are 24", are there any 26" options? And the big question, where can I buy them without paying a ridiculous amount?
 
I don't recall seeing any whitewalls bigger than 26 x 2.125.

Here's an option, if you don't have your wheels yet, consider a set of wider rims. I've seen a ton of bikes on the euro forum were they mount 'standard' balloon tires to 65mm (~2.5 in.) and 80mm (~3 in.)wide rims. This changes the profile of the tires dramatically and makes them look fatter and may offer more fender clearance as well.

Now, granted they are not cheap, but you could save $$$ using a commonly avaialble tire, which may fit into your 'overall' budget.
